Dino Rex

Dino Rex (1992)

by Taito
Genres:Fighting
Game modes:Single player, Multiplayer
Story:A game where a different types of dinosaurs fight each other using their teeth and claws until one defeats the other. All dinosaurs have little human masters. The master of the losing dino will be eaten at the end of the fight. Taito, the Dino Rex maker, released 403 different machines in our database under this trade name, starting in 1967. Other machines made by Taito during the time period Dino Rex was produced include Arabian Magic, Dead Connection, Euro Champ '92, Galactic Storm, Grid Seeker: Project Storm Hammer, Star Trax, Warrior Blade: Rastan Saga Episode III, Racing Beat, Pu-Li-Ru-La, and Power Blade.Show more

Spider-Man: Web of Shadows
Spider-Man: Web of ShadowsSpider-Man: Web of Shadows is a video game title encompassing three versions: a full-3D action game for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 3, Wii, and Xbox 360; a 2.5D sidescrolling beat em up action game for the PlayStation Portable and PlayStation 2 (called Amazing Allies Edition), and a 2.5D side-scrolling brawler/platformer for the Nintendo DS. Spider-Man: Web of Shadows, along with most other games published by Activision that had used the Marvel licence, was de-listed and removed from all digital storefronts on January 1, 2014.

Supreme Warrior
Supreme WarriorSupreme Warrior is a full-motion video fighting game. The game, or interactive movie, is set in China hundreds of years ago. You are tasked with protecting half of a magical mask. The wearer of the mask will be granted untold power. Unfortunately, the villanous Wang Tu has the other half of the mask, and wants your half badly. So, you must fight off Wang Tu's minions, and eventually Fang Tu himself. The gameplay in Supreme Warrior consists of digitized video with interactive elements. At many points during the video, you can unleash a punch, kick, or block. If your timing is correct, you inflict damage on your opponent. If you timing is off, your opponent hurts you.

Plasma Sword: Nightmare of Bilstein
Plasma Sword: Nightmare of BilsteinPlasma Sword: Nightmare of Bilstein is a 3D weapon-based fighting video game released by Capcom for the arcades. It is the sequel to Star Gladiator and runs on the ZN-2 hardware, an improved version of PlayStation-based ZN-1 hardware its predecessor ran on. A Dreamcast port was released in 2000.

Dissidia Final Fantasy Arcade
Dissidia Final Fantasy ArcadeThe RPG/fighting game phenomenon from Square Enix returns with an all-new 3-on-3 battle style and evolved visuals in this original arcade fighter. The initial game roster featured 14 heroes representing the main entries from the series, with villains and additional heroes added in subsequent updates. The game was later adapted for PlayStation 4 as Dissidia Final Fantasy NT.
